What is one advantage of using Amazon CloudFront?

One significant advantage of using Amazon CloudFront is its ability to provide a Content Delivery Network (CDN) for high-speed global data delivery. CloudFront accelerates the distribution of content to end users by caching copies of content at various edge locations around the world. When a user requests content, CloudFront delivers it from the nearest edge location, which greatly reduces latency and improves load times compared to delivering it from a centralized data center.

This capability enhances the user experience, especially for geographically dispersed audiences, as it ensures that content is served quickly and reliably. Additionally, CloudFront supports various content types, including websites, APIs, and streaming media, making it a versatile choice for businesses looking to optimize content delivery.

While other services in the AWS ecosystem may focus on aspects such as storage scaling, data encryption, or user permissions, CloudFront's primary function as a CDN clearly distinguishes its advantage in facilitating high-speed global data delivery.
